比特币是一种加密货币,它的公式被称为比特币协议,比特币的公式包罗了数学、密码学和计算机科学等多个范畴的常识,用于实现比特币的发行、交易和平安性。
1. 比特币的发行公式比特币的发行公式是通过挖矿来实现的,挖矿是指通过计算复杂的数学问题来验证比特币交易并添加到比特币的区块链中,挖矿的过程中,矿工需要处理一个称为工做量证明(Proof-of-Work)的问题,那个问题需要破费大量的计算资本和时间来处理,处理问题后,矿工将获得必然数量的比特币做为奖励。
比特币的发行公式能够用以下数学公式暗示:
新发行的比特币数量 = 区块奖励 + 交易手续费
区块奖励是指矿工获得的比特币奖励,它的数量会跟着时间的推移而削减,比特币协议规定,每210,000个区块,区块奖励减半一次,那被称为“哈尔守恒”(Halving),区块奖励为6.25个比特币。
交易手续费是指比特币交易中付出给矿工的费用,用于鼓励矿工验证交易,交易手续费的数量取决于交易的复杂性和收集拥堵情况。
2. 比特币的交易公式比特币的交易公式是通过利用非对称加密算法来实现的,每个比特币用户都有一对密钥,包罗公钥和私钥,公钥用于生成比特币地址,私钥用于对交易停止数字签名。
比特币的交易公式能够用以下步调来描述:
1. 发送方创建一笔交易,并指定领受方的比特币地址和交易金额。
2. 发送方利用本身的私钥对交易停止数字签名。
3. 发送方将签名和交易信息一路播送到比特币收集中。
4. 矿工验证交易的有效性,包罗验证发送方的数字签名和交易金额能否契合规则。
5. 若是交易有效,矿工将该交易添加到一个新的区块中,并播送给整个收集。
比特币的交易公式利用了非对称加密算法,确保了交易的平安性和不成窜改性,只要拥有准确的私钥才气对交易停止签名,那意味着只要发送刚才能倡议交易,而且交易在被添加到区块链之后是无法更改的。
3. 比特币的平安性公式比特币的平安性公式是通过利用密码学算法来实现的,比特币收集接纳了一种称为哈希函数(Hash Function)的算法,用于庇护交易和区块的完好性。
比特币的平安性公式能够用以下步调来描述:
1. 每个区块包罗了前一个区块的哈希值,如许构成了一个由区块构成的链条,称为区块链。
2. 每个区块的哈希值是通过将区块中的交易数据和前一个区块的哈希值停止计算得到的。
3. 若是有人试图更改某个区块中的交易数据,那么该区块的哈希值将会发作变革,从而毁坏了区块链的完好性。
4. 为了庇护区块链的完好性,比特币收集要求矿工通过处理工做量证明问题来添加新的区块,如许做的目标是为了确保只要拥有足够计算才能的矿工才气修改区块链。
比特币的平安性公式利用了哈希函数和工做量证明机造,确保了比特币收集的平安性和抗攻击性,因为比特币收集的去中心化特征,任何人都能够参与挖矿,那使得比特币收集具有了较高的平安性。
总结起来,比特币的公式涉及了发行、交易和平安性等方面,比特币的发行公式通过挖矿来实现,交易公式通过利用非对称加密算法停止数字签名和验证,平安性公式通过利用哈希函数和工做量证明机造来庇护交易和区块的完好性,那些公式的运做使得比特币成为了一种平安、去中心化的加密货币。